I am pleased that you liked the museum, If I may correct your observations re the taking of photographs in the museum we do allow photographs to be taken in the museum all we ask is that visitors seek permission first & that the photos are for their own personnal use. As for other Do Not signs these are no dogs (except guide dogs), food or drink and a request not to touch the items on display as many of them have very sharp edges.
As for the two jets outside we agree with your comments unfortunatley they belong to the National Museum of the USAF and we have been waiting for them to be removed for 5 years since the F100 was damaged by a crashing Turbo Beaver.

We would be very happy for you to have the F100! Unfortunatley the NMUSAF will not talk to us (we have had no contact since early 2008) despite many atempts on our part. Having spent a lot of money on the restoration of our Fieseler Fi103R-4 Reichenberg & now investing a lot of money building a new display hall the museum is let down by the F100 & Mystere which do not belong to us & reflect very badly on the NMUSAF!
